ok, So I have a read-only DMG that I need to be able to edit the contents of.
I have duplicated this image as many ways I can think of.
I have used Carbon Copy Cloner to create a (Read-Write) sparse image of it, when I get info on the DMG it says I (my user) have read-write access. However I dont! ugh!
I tried to 'Convert' it to read-write using disk utility, no luck..
I even went to the specific folder I need write access for and tried to chmod it (777) and it comes back, 'Read-only file system'
How do I convert a Read only DMG to a Read/Write disk image?
